What is the Daman Game?
The Daman Game is a traditional game that’s played in many parts of the world, particularly in South Asia. It’s simple yet incredibly engaging. Players use small, polished stones or marbles (called “daman”) to hit targets or knock over objects. The rules can vary from place to place, but the core idea remains the same: skill, precision, and a bit of luck.
What makes the Daman Game unique isn’t just the gameplay—it’s the way it brings people together. Unlike modern video games or solo activities, the Daman Game is inherently social. It’s played in open spaces, often in neighborhoods, parks, or community centers, where people of all ages can gather, watch, and cheer.
